Output 50a421fcb25e4944a75e234b9b6b978c0c557e5152d86281820cd417a283cc67:3

value
3528530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813cb42a8c467d5d36b01a3c1ae62ac6ec97af77 OP_EQUAL
address
3DUMp4Z18bh3v1e4bHCd3dxtaLdhxTUvz9
transaction
50a421fcb25e4944a75e234b9b6b978c0c557e5152d86281820cd417a283cc67
spent
true